Kitchen Electrical & Bathroom Plumbing

We did a little electrical on the kitchen and installed the rough-in plumbing for the bathroom. Included is a quick tour of our "lovely" kitchen and then you will sympathize with the need to remodel! Check out Bree’s cutification of her computer case :)

now that I have the pan for the shower, I
can determine exactly where all my
plumbing fixtures need to go
for
instance, the drain, the p-trap and so on
it tends to be the typical place that a
shower controller for your hot
and your cold
are at
to make all this
work, I need to have all of the plumbing
in as far as connections made, caps put
on for the rough in and the p-trap
its
location
have all that done before I cut
it into the two pipes that are live
the hot and cold water and so
we only have to be out of
water for a short period of time
the connectors for the toilets, for cold
water and the sink also need to be put
in at the same time so that we can seal
up the floor
